Another thing to fall [sound recording] / Laura Lippman.

Lippman, Laura, 1959- (Author). Emond, Linda. (narrator).

Summary:

A Hollywoood-based TV production company filming a new miniseries in Baltimore is hitting a steady stream of unexpected snags. With unions grumbling and less than favorable press, the staff also finds itself beset by vandalism and a growing number of accidents on set. Worried for the safety of his cast, Flip Tumulty hires Tess Monaghan to keep an eye on the show's saucy 20-year-old starlet, Selene. When Tess discovers photos of Selene--all taken by the same stalker--Tess goes on high alert. Then a murderer strikes, and Tess must reassess the situation to avert disaster.
